Do you know Blender can work for you with the Mirror tool?
Yes sir, just design a part of an object and Blender will do the rest!
It works for specular mesh only, but this is the case, our chair can be modeled for half only, so this is the trick, use CTRL + R, move the mouse on the half of the chair till you see a violet line, confirm with a double click, do it for the back chair and the seat:
now from the front view select the left vertices, and delete them with X:
Select all the left vertex of the remaining mesh, use Shift + S and Cursor to selected :
Press T and set origin to 3d Cursor:
From the properties panel on the right get the Mirror:
Wow, now the chair is still here but you just need to work on half of it!
Details are very important in a realistic 3d, so give it up to get a better seat, use edge loop to divide it in the Z axis:
Change mesh select mode to face with CTRL + TAB, select the right face and extrude a little bit out with E:
Do the same with the front faces, in this case there are 2 to extrude, just select both using Shift:
Now change Mesh select mode to Edge,and select the edge of the top seat:
To obtain a smooth border there is another helpful tool: the Bevel!
CTRL + B and rotate the wheel mouse to increment of the effect:
There's a little problem due the scale we used to change misure of the initial cube, no problem we can rest it with in object mode with CTRL+ A
Now we can apply the Bevel tool:
Press T to show the transform panel on the left, click Smooth on the Shading:
Very good, but all the chair looks smooth... and we want the border only!
Very easy, another tool we will work on it, from Properties panel add the modifier Edge Split, done!
Another F12 for rendering and this is the result, always better!

Lesson 3: change shape to the chair with the edit mode
Today we will discover an incredibly powerful tool, the edit mode, to enter it just select from the low bar or with the Tab key, the object change and are visible vertex, edges and faces:
Press A to deselect vertex, and select just the top chair, use B (square selection) or C (circle selection), the four vertex should be orange like below, and scale them down on the Y axis, so use S and Y:
Deselect again, and select the lower vertex of the legs, all the 16, change view to Top with 7, change mesh select mode in Face with CTRL+Tab and from the bar the pivot point in Individual origins, scale just a little bit:
From right view with 3, select the vertex of the front legs, snap them to the seat, after do the same with the other two legs:
Select the top chair vertex again and snap to the seat:
From front view with 1, select the left lower vertex and snap to the seat, do the same with the right legs:
Done! You can change color to material for a better look:
And with a quick render this is the result, just a few clicks and the chair looks more realistics and professionally made!
